A Day in the Life The Vascular Field Technologist will Promotes and supports Medtronic's Vascular products and services within an assigned geographic area (Los Angeles/Southern CA and Las Vegas, NV. This person will partner with field-based Clinical Service Managers, Clinical Specialists, Sales Reps, and District Managers within the team to ensure the right product is in the right place at the right time.

Will drive adoption and support of Medtronic Vascular products and services across Los Angeles, Southern California, and Las Vegas, NV, ensuring exceptional customer support and alignment with business objectives. Will partner closely with Clinical Service Managers, Clinical Specialists, Sales Representatives, and District Managers to ensure the right product is available in the right location at the right time, maximizing customer satisfaction and revenue opportunities. This person must reside in the Los Angeles, CA area.

No relocation is available for this position. Responsibilities may include the following and other duties may be assigned. Drive sales growth and therapy adoption by promoting and advancing Medtronic Vascular products and services across assigned territories and customer accounts, consistently meeting or exceeding performance objectives.

Cultivate and expand strategic relationships with physicians, clinicians, administrators, and key decision-makers to influence purchasing decisions, strengthen partnerships, and accelerate business growth. Identify and convert new business opportunities by proactively assessing customer needs, delivering value-based solutions, navigating objections, and demonstrating the clinical and economic benefits of Medtronic's vascular portfolio. Lead product education and training initiatives that increase customer competency, drive product utilization, and support successful therapy implementation.

Analyze market trends, customer insights, and competitive intelligence to uncover growth opportunities, anticipate market shifts, and inform territory and account strategies. Develop and execute targeted market development plans that expand market share, increase account penetration, and drive sustainable revenue growth. Capture, synthesize, and champion customer feedback on new and existing products, partnering with R&D, Operations, and Marketing to influence product enhancements, innovation, and commercial strategy.

Build strong cross-functional partnerships with Marketing, Finance, Human Resources, Sales Training, and other business functions to solve complex challenges, remove barriers, and accelerate organizational priorities. Serve as a trusted advisor and clinical resource to customers, providing consultative support that strengthens customer loyalty, improves outcomes, and positions Medtronic as the partner of choice. Drive strategic account growth through proactive engagement , disciplined territory management, and effective execution of sales and business development initiatives.

Required Qualifications Bachelor’s degree Minimum of 2 years of relevant experience Must have a valid driver's license and active vehicle insurance policy.
